Jeep Brand Appoints Bob Broderdorf to CEO

The Jeep® brand announced Bob Broderdorf as its new Chief Executive Officer (CEO). Broderdorf, who previously served as senior vice president and head of Jeep brand for North America, has more than 25 years of experience leading iconic American brands, including Ram and Dodge. He has a proven track record of driving growth and profitability through strong dealer relationships, breakthrough marketing and strategic go-to-market planning.

Broderdorf succeeds previous Jeep Brand CEO Antonio Filosa, who will continue to oversee the Chrysler, Dodge, Jeep and Ram brands in his position as America's regions chief operating officer (COO) of Stellantis.

“We are thrilled to appoint Bob to drive the legendary Jeep brand forward during this transformational time,” said Filosa, America’s regions COO, Stellantis. “Having had the pleasure working closely with him over the years, I couldn’t be more confident in Bob’s leadership. Since November 2024 alone, Bob has grown Jeep brand market share by 16% and reduced inventory by over 30% in the U.S. The growth plan Bob established for North America has set a strong foundation to launch into 2025, and I look forward to continuing to work alongside him to introduce more Jeep vehicles globally than ever before.”

Broderdorf will head a new leadership team for the Jeep brand, merging North America and global operations into one group managing sales, operations, product, communications and marketing. This includes the appointment of Mike Koval to the role of senior vice president and head of sales operations for the brand. Most recently, Koval was the senior vice president of Mopar in North America and previously served as CEO of Ram where he oversaw consistent years of sales success and market share growth.

“I’m honoured to step into the Jeep brand CEO role to build upon the strong foundation established by Antonio and the team,” said Broderdorf, Jeep brand CEO. “Leading a brand with such a rich history is both a privilege and a responsibility. This year, we will strengthen the brand with a strategic investment of over $3 billion across the business to rebuild trust with our dealers and introduce new products that will resonate with our customers. I look forward to working closely with our talented team to drive a transformative evolutution for the Jeep brand.”
